You want to combine permanova and permdisp, since they test different hypothesis. Permanova asks if there is a difference in either within or between group distance for any of my groups. Permdisp tests the hypothesis that there is a significant difference in within group variance.
So, my hope is that I see a large signal in permanova and a small one in permdisp, because that suggests that my difference is driven by differences between communities compared to differences within one of my communities.
